Slapstick Weekly
Slapstick is aimed at artists in good physical shape wishing to discover modern slapstick which is a physical humor taking place in a comic conflicting context.
Slapstick Weekly Class
It offers participants to learn the basic techniques of slapstick, such as: slaps, falls, collisions, accidents and assaults.
The different figures that will be taught come from classic structures inspired by silent cinema, modern theater and clown. Participants will learn to perform them with the right technique, the right timing, and most importantly, safely and playfully. Each session begins with a warm up and ends with sequences composed of the movements of the day.
